Here is what Sourav Ganguly thinks on including KL Rahul in the playing XI

Posted by Cricadium on November 2nd, 2018

After India won the first One Day International of the five-match ODI series at Guwahati by 8 wickets. The West Indies performed strongly in the next two ODIs. The second One Day International ended in a tie at Visakhapatnam while in the third One Day International at Pune, Windies won by 43 runs defeating India.


But India regained its form in the fourth ODI and beat Windies to took the lead by 2-1 before the fifth One Day International scheduled at Greenfield International Stadium, Thiruvananthapuram.


Former Indian captain Sourav Ganguly’s appealed to include KL Rahul in the playing XI for the 4th and the 5th ODI series against the Windies.


KL Rahul was left out of the team for the fourth consecutive game of the series in Mumbai. KL Rahul has been named as a backup opener. Rohit Sharma and Shikhar Dhawan are the preferred options in ODIs.


Sourav Ganguly is not convinced about the decision and argues for Rahul to be in the starting XI in India’s ODI. He told that India has a lot to think about. He still believes Lokesh Rahul should not be sitting out. He told that the middle-order desperately needs to be given a good look. The selectors are leaving it too late, he added.


On Virat Kohli’s record of three successive centuries and brilliant performances in ODIs against West Indies and on comparing Virat Kohli with past legends, Ganguly has an opinion that instead of comparing the current Indian captain with legends of the past era, one should sit back and enjoy his class and penchant to score runs.


Ganguly added, “Coming to India, once again it has totally been a Virat Kohli show. One is at a loss of words when it comes to talking about his superlative talent.”


Sourav Ganguly said that there are already a lot of comparisons. Ganguly’s point is simple: “let statistics take care of themselves. Rather, what we should be doing is sitting back and enjoying this man’s class. Along with his ability as a player what stands out is his hunger for runs.”
